And now, the company has moved from words to actions. They write on the web that the novelty appeared on the South Korean market. At the same time, there is information that even older car owners from other countries have access to it.

Interestingly, BMW avoids loud announcements of a new service in every possible way. Moreover, the automaker was unable to directly answer the journalists’ relevant question.

In terms of pricing, a heated seat subscription costs $18 per month. The annual tariff will cost a little less – $180. There’s also the option to buy the feature outright for $415. There’s also the option to subscribe to a heated steering wheel for $10 per month.
